Cet objet body contient sous forme de propriétés les paramètres du formulaire. let express = require('express'); let bodyParser = require("body-parser"); (bodyParser. urlencoded({ extended: true})); let p1 =; ("p1=" + p1);}); Dans l'exemple ci-dessus, on affiche les valeurs des paramètres dans la console Le code de l'exemple complet let express = require('express'); ndFile( __dirname + '/');}); ("p1=" + p1);});
Une question? Pas de panique, on va vous aider! Débutant perdu... 16 juin 2020 à 17:43:12 Bonjour débutant en dev, je rame à créer ma première appli toute simple, je veux créer un xml à partir d'un simple formulaire et je souhaite que la page html garde ses valeur au moment du submit, j'ai pas mal cherché mais sans succès. il faut juste que j'arrive à renvoyer mes valeurs à ma page, mais je ne trouve pas la solution... si quelqu'un peut m'éclairer, merci beaucoup! voila mon html
Si vous essayez d'utiliser la commande express ou de vérifier la version d'Express installée à l'aide de express --version, vous recevrez une réponse indiquant qu'Express est introuvable. Si vous souhaitez procéder à une installation globale d'Express afin de pouvoir l'utiliser à volonté, utilisez: npm install -g express-generator. Pour consulter la liste des packages qui ont été installés par npm, utilisez: npm list. Ils sont triés par profondeur (nombre de répertoires imbriqués). Les packages que vous avez installés sont à la profondeur 0, leurs dépendances à la profondeur 1, les suivantes à la profondeur 2 et ainsi de suite. Pour plus d'informations, consultez Différence entre npx et npm sur StackOverflow. Examinez les fichiers et dossiers inclus dans le projet Express en ouvrant celui-ci dans VS Code: code. Les fichiers générés par Express créent une application web dont l'architecture qui peut sembler impressionnante au premier abord. La fenêtre Explorer de VS Code (accessible via Ctrl + Maj + E) montre que les fichiers et dossiers suivants ont été générés: bin contient le fichier exécutable qui lance l'application.
point de départ de l'application. Il charge tout et commence à traiter les demandes des utilisateurs. C'est en somme le ciment qui maintient toutes les pièces ensemble. contient la description du projet, le gestionnaire de scripts et le manifeste de l'application. Son rôle principal est d'assurer le suivi des dépendances de l'application et de leurs versions respectives. Vous devez maintenant installer les dépendances qu'Express utilise pour créer et exécuter votre application Express HelloWorld (packages utilisés pour des tâches telles que l'exécution du serveur, comme défini dans le fichier). Dans VS Code, ouvrez votre terminal en sélectionnant Afficher > Terminal (ou sélectionnez Ctrl + `, en utilisant le caractère d'impulsion), et assurez-vous que vous êtes toujours dans le répertoire du projet « HelloWorld ». Installez les dépendances du package Express: npm install L'infrastructure est maintenant définie pour une application web de plusieurs pages ayant accès à un large éventail d'API, de méthodes utilitaires HTTP et d'intergiciels (middleware), ce qui facilite la création d'une API robuste.
Pensez utilisateur! Vous avez forcément été confronté vous-même à des formulaires fastidieux. Ne répétez pas les mêmes erreurs et inspirez-vous des bonnes idées que vous rencontrez. Le contrôle par le navigateur Certains navigateurs récents ont implémenté chacun à leur niveau des fonctionnalités internes de contrôle de saisie sur les formulaires. Une couche supplémentaire codé par le site permet de fiabiliser les saisies à un niveau commun. Chaque navigateur utilise sa propre interface pour l'affichage des messages qu'il n'est pas possible de modifier. Préparons un formulaire qui utilise les principaux contrôles du navigateur pour demander à l'utilisateur quelle contribution il est prêt à accorder: